Output 9310183756fadd07213dac101240e42e8c54a66cd0a32bc0572e13b86a1245fc:0

value
27402376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2299f61c1dc7ea736b7afd8fa9f48cb0642595ec OP_EQUAL
address
MB47eNk8XKpfMoy3irAdCgDd6kTCLrg66t
transaction
9310183756fadd07213dac101240e42e8c54a66cd0a32bc0572e13b86a1245fc
spent
true